Output ef84a059d61f918bb3758bb82af1c231fd56ad49e6dbbe2364eebb12e660494c:1

value
1919692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d34845827c7d4912b8bf5636557aa26d8c3aa46 OP_EQUAL
address
3G2EvbzjX4nBb8GKoe8GjYSvDY9JEh94Ss
transaction
ef84a059d61f918bb3758bb82af1c231fd56ad49e6dbbe2364eebb12e660494c
spent
true